### Broker upgrade procedure (Pipewren cluster)

Upgrade Pipewren brokers one node at a time, never in parallel. Before touching a node: verify replication is fully caught up, confirm no partition has a single in-sync replica, and announce the window in the ops channel. After each node rejoins, wait for rebalancing to finish before proceeding — rushing this step caused the March outage. Version compatibility notes, rollback steps, and the node ordering table are maintained on the page below.

wiki page, bawef-hafop: https://jira.nelvroworks.corp/job/pages/projects/7c5c0f440dbd

**Item 7 — Cache invalidation, Tindervale product catalog.** Verify purge events fire on every SKU update; stale entries past 10 minutes are a sev-3. Check the invalidation queue depth before and after the nightly sync. If purges stall, flush the Corvid cache tier manually and log the incident. Escalation for unresolved staleness goes to the owner named below.

account owner for bawip-tahag: Raleth Quenok

## Deploying the Gatewick Proctor Queue

Deploys are pretty painless: push to main, wait for the pipeline, then watch the queue drain dashboard for five minutes. If candidates pile up mid-exam, roll back first and ask questions later — the queue replays safely. Everything the workers care about lives in one config block, shown here for reference.

settings of bafof-yagef:
JOROX_PIN=8740
JOROX_TENANT=pelox
JOROX_METRICS_HOST=metrics.jorox.qorvelworks.internal
JOROX_SEAL=seal_c78f63c1
JOROX_STANDBY_TEAM=norax

The Furrowlink telemetry gateway accepts sensor payloads from field equipment over mutually authenticated channels, then forwards normalized readings to the internal Grainledger analytics service. For the security review, note that the gateway-to-Grainledger hop uses a static service key rather than short-lived tokens; rotation is manual and logged. Audit scope should include verifying this key's age and access scope. The key currently in use is shown below.

app token of kaduf-hagug = vxb4-Q0rH